In law, "reinstated" refers to the restoration of a legal status, right, or position that had previously been revoked, terminated, or suspended. This term is often used in the context of employment, where an employee may be reinstated to their job after a wrongful termination or disciplinary action. Reinstatement can also apply to legal rights, such as the reinstatement of a lapsed license or permit. Essentially, it signifies a return to a prior state of legal standing or entitlement.
